SimpleFX Pros & Cons
- the ability to open an account in cryptocurrency;
- the minimum deposit amount is $1;
- its trading platform is the Metatrader 4.
- the inability to withdraw funds to a bank card;
- no multilingual technical support;
- the broker doesn't have a financial regulator;
- the broker provides only one account type.
TU Expert Verdict
SimpleFX carries a higher degree of risk. My review and user feedback point to noticeable performance issues and limitations. It may be appropriate only for experienced traders who fully understand the risks and are prepared for potential instability.

FAQs
How high are trading costs and non-trading fees at SimpleFX?
SimpleFX has been rated as having medium overall fees, with a commissions and fees score of 5/10. Forex trading costs are described as above average, and the broker does not offer ECN/Raw spread accounts, but there are no inactivity, deposit, or withdrawal fees according to the review.
What account types does SimpleFX provide and what are their key trading parameters?
SimpleFX offers a Demo account and a single live Standard account, with no VIP, micro, cent, swap-free, or managed account options mentioned. The Standard account has a minimum deposit from $1, minimum spreads from 0.9 pips on currency pairs, leverage up to 1:500, a minimum lot size of 0.01, and margin call/stop-out levels of 20%/20%.
What do user reviews and feedback say about SimpleFX overall?
SimpleFX has a user satisfaction score of 5.7/10 based on 31 reviews, with a rating distribution that shows 3% 5-star, 26% 4-star, 39% 3-star, 16% 2-star, and 16% 1-star evaluations. According to user reviews, overall sentiment is mixed, reflecting a balance of positive, neutral, and negative experiences.
What reviews and ratings does the SimpleFX mobile app receive on iOS and Android?
SimpleFX supports mobile trading on both iOS and Android, with a mobile section score of 6.45/10 and indicator support but no mobile alerts or mobile 2FA. Based on available user reviews, the iOS app has a 5/5 rating and the Android app has a 3.9 rating on Google Play, with around 50,000 total downloads reported in the review.
How responsive is SimpleFX customer support according to user comments and testing?
Customer support at SimpleFX is described as available but with moderate response times, and some requests may require follow-ups. Support operates 24/5 via online chat, email, and the Support section in the personal account, but there is no weekend service, no telephone support, no feedback form, and the average response time is reported as about a week.
